“Too expensive for the type room we got”
3 of 5 stars Reviewed 6 February 2012
1
person found this review helpful

I agree with a couple other reviews - Church Landing is a gorgeous spot, the views are unbeatable, the beds are very comfortable and the staff very friendly, but...
We have very happily stayed here before, but in a regular room. This time, we stayed in the Cathedral Suite for a very special occasion (& a very high price), and I guess I just expected a lot more when paying well over $400 per night. First off, this is not a "suite", but just one very large single room, which frankly had a lot of wasted space. The WIFI only worked if you sat in one particular corner, which was not comfortable. The room overall was dark, and the furnishings/rugs looked tired & drab. The sofa, for example, had really worn cushions, and the wall paper in some spots noticeably needed to be replaced. There does not appear to be cental heat, but only 2 window units which ran quite loudly. I know folks come here for the rustic "camp" look, but then I think it should be priced accordingly. There was an alcove with a small table & chairs in it, but the chairs had broken back slats, uneven legs, and the wooden wall covering did not look professionally installed (I'm being kind here). For the price we paid I expected more than mis-matched furniture, a scratched up table, and a curtain instead of a closet door. Again, it's a beautiful spot, and I actually would stay here again, but only in a regular room, which as I recall had everything the Cathedral "suite" had, just on a smaller, cozier, and much less expensive scale.

“Great Winter Escape”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 29 January 2012
1
person found this review helpful

My husband and I just returned from a one night stay at Church Landing. We were looking to do some skiing during the day and enjoy some quiet relaxation by the fireplace at night. We chose this hotel based on Tripadvisor reviews and were not disappointed. My rating is really 4 and half stars - but decided to round up instead of down because we immensely enjoyed our stay and would not hesitate to return.

The hotel has a very warm, cozy and luxurious feel to it, with fireplaces throughout the common areas and gorgeous views of the lake. Our room was well appointed, clean, spacious and with a great balcony and fireplace in the room. Previous reviews about the beds being extremely soft are accurate - I really enjoyed the marshmellowy bedding, however my husband was a bit uncomfortable. There is complimentary coffee, tea and hot chocolate available at all hours - as well as danishes and muffins in the morning for breakfast.

Our only complaint - which isn't the fault of the hotel - is that there seemed to be a lot of children staying at the resort. We weren't able to use the hot tub because it was full of children whenever we wanted to use it - and could hear children screaming at the outdoor tub/pool from outside (as our room was fairly close to the pool). Additionally, there was a group of children playing hockey in the hallway outside our room for about 30 minutes - repeatedly hitting our door with their hockey sticks and running up and down the hall. Normally this wouldn't bother me, but my husband and I were there to relax and enjoy the peaceful surroundings. I finally decided to call the front desk and they sent someone within 10 minutes to stop them.

All in all, we would absolutely return to this hotel if we return next winter. I would just make sure to reserve a room as far away from the pool as possible.
